Pelicans Form Trade Agreement with Nashua Pride of Can-Am League

August 1, 2006 - American Association (AA)
Pensacola Pelicans News Release


The Pensacola Pelicans announced today a trade agreement with the Nashua Pride of the Can-Am League. Nashua receives first baseman and designated hitter Larry Bethea in exchange for a 2007 first round draft pick and financial considerations.

"I would like to thank Larry for what he has done for this organization and the community over the past couple years," said Pelicans general manager Talmadge Nunnari. "It's always tough to lose a key player but this is a good move for Larry. He has the chance to go to Nashua and make an immediate impact and play every day."

In his third season with the Pelicans, Bethea is hitting .298 with 10 doubles, 7 homeruns, 36 RBI, 9 stolen bases, and has scored 30 runs.
